Archaeologists Make Stunning Find: Ancient Tombs Uncovered at the Pyramids of Giza Date Back to Early Dynastic Period – Between 2563 – 2423 BC. These tombs belonged to two esteemed individuals, identified as high-ranking men who served under King Khafre’s priests, shedding light on the ancient past of Saturday. Egypt’s antiquities ministry said one of the men in one of the tombs was named Behnui-Ka, who held seven titles including the Priest and the Judge to the Pharaoh.

The other tomb belonged to another man named Nwi, who served as Chief of the Great Estate and ‘purifier’ of the Khafre. Khafre, also known as Khephren or Chephren to the Ancient Greeks, built the second of the three famous Pyramids of Giza as well as the Sphinx.

‘Many artifacts were discovered in the tombs,’ the ministry said, including limestone statues of one of the tomb’s owner, his wife and son, statues of jackals, as well as hieroglyphs.

Renowned Egyptologist Zahi Hawass, who attended a press conference, told Egypt Today: ‘The whole world is watching this great discovery that dates back to the early dynasty.’

Khafre was an Egyptian king, from the Fourth Dynasty of the Old Kingdom in ancient Egypt. He ascended the throne after the death of his elder brother Djedefre, around 2570 BC. He ruled Egypt for 26 years and was succeeded by his son, Menkaure.

Khafre was reportedly succeeded by a king named Bikeris, according to the record of the ancient historian Manetho, but nothing else is known about him. There is no Egyptian inscription or Westcar papyrus documents discovered from an ancient site to tell us more about Khafre. Several artifacts recently discovered clearly indicate that Menkaure was the direct successor of his father.

Khafre was also called Khephren, Khefren, and Chephren, using the local Egyptian language. There is much dispute regarding the reign period of this Pharaoh, as there is nothing clearly written anywhere on this account.

Although the ancient historian Manetho wrote in his records that Khafre’s reign continued for 66 years, modern historians do not accept that fact and believe that he ruled for a little more than 26 years.

Khafre was known to be a cruel and harsh ruler. He closed down many of the temples of Egypt, following the trend started by his father Khufu. The Pyramid built by Khafre is considered to be the second largest of its kind, built in the Giza necropolis. It was named as ‘Wer(en)-Khafre’, in the Egyptian language, which meant ‘Khafre is Great’.

The huge structure, made of Turah limestone blocks, also consists of a valley temple, a mortuary temple, and the Sphinx temple, to support the colossal Great Sphinx of Giza, apart from the main pyramid. Several statues of Khafre are found from the Valley temple, where fragments of inscriptions are found with the Horus name of Khafre on them. The base of the pyramid was made of pink granite slabs, which were arranged one after another, a unique architectural feature that started from the design of this pyramid.
